MINUTES — Management Meeting, Support Outsourcing

Attendees: ops, finance, sales leads.

Decision pending on moving tier-1 support to Merrowby Services. Their Thornfield centre passed the audit. Cost model shows 22% savings year one; quality KPIs to be contractually fixed. Tier-2 stays in-house. Transition window: eight weeks, phased by product line. Sales to brief key accounts before cutover — no external comms yet. Final vote next Thursday. The strategic basis for the move is summarised below.

board note of bawep-tajef: Queniusek Systems plans to raise the Quenvan list price by 53.1 percent in March. The pricing group signed off on a budget of $176.4 million for Project Drueth. The renewal with Casionix Partners closes at $142.5 million a year, 8.3 percent below the last contract. Project Fraax slips by six weeks because of the tooling delay.

Welcome to the Ferngate transcoding farm codebase. Workers pull jobs from the Quillhopper queue, transcode via the segment pipeline, and report status to the internal Ledgerline service. Review focus: retry logic in worker/dispatch.go and codec fallbacks. Local runs need a Ledgerline credential exported before starting the worker. Use the key below for your sandbox environment.

app token of kagap-fahag = zpat2_0m

Fix double-booking when Larkwell calendar sync races with local edits. Root cause: conflict window was wider than the poll interval, so stale events overwrote fresh ones. We now take a lease before merging and drop events older than the lease epoch. New folks: read the merge logic in sync_core before touching this. The constants below control lease and poll behavior.

limits module of tafop-hahop:
WEIGHTS = {
    "julmir": 223,
    "belox": 987,
    "lamion": 470,
    "pelath": 609,
    "fraok": 1010,
    "eliion": 343,
    "drudor": 342,
}